About 2-[4-[1-[(4-chlorophenyl)methyl]-2,4-dioxoquinazolin-3-yl]phenyl]-N-methylacetamide
2-[4-[1-[(4-chlorophenyl)methyl]-2,4-dioxoquinazolin-3-yl]phenyl]-N-methylacetamide (PubChem CID 50763349) has the molecular formula C24H20ClN3O3
and a molecular weight of 433.90 g/mol. Its IUPAC name is 2-[4-[1-[(4-chlorophenyl)methyl]-2,4-dioxoquinazolin-3-yl]phenyl]-N-methylacetamide.

What is the SMILES notation for 2-[4-[1-[(4-chlorophenyl)methyl]-2,4-dioxoquinazolin-3-yl]phenyl]-N-methylacetamide?
The canonical SMILES for 2-[4-[1-[(4-chlorophenyl)methyl]-2,4-dioxoquinazolin-3-yl]phenyl]-N-methylacetamide is CNC(=O)Cc1ccc(-n2c(=O)c3ccccc3n(Cc3ccc(Cl)cc3)c2=O)cc1.
What is the InChIKey of 2-[4-[1-[(4-chlorophenyl)methyl]-2,4-dioxoquinazolin-3-yl]phenyl]-N-methylacetamide?
The InChIKey is DNAGWOUSPNEIOF-UHFFFAOYSA-N. The full InChI is InChI=1S/C24H20ClN3O3/c1-26-22(29)14-16-8-12-19(13-9-16)28-23(30)20-4-2-3-5-21(20)27(24(28)31)15-17-6-10-18(25)11-7-17/h2-13H,14-15H2,1H3,(H,26,29).
What are the key properties of 2-[4-[1-[(4-chlorophenyl)methyl]-2,4-dioxoquinazolin-3-yl]phenyl]-N-methylacetamide?
2-[4-[1-[(4-chlorophenyl)methyl]-2,4-dioxoquinazolin-3-yl]phenyl]-N-methylacetamide has a molecular weight of 433.90 g/mol, XLogP of 3.14, 5 rotatable bonds, 1 hydrogen bond donors, and 5 hydrogen bond acceptors.
